Transaction e3dfee0efb31603712325d46f93d70fad059b1aa8b22f70b0deb980cd868266c
1 Input
1 Output
-
e3dfee0efb31603712325d46f93d70fad059b1aa8b22f70b0deb980cd868266c:0
- value
- 248036
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6704e623c7fe195311eacc812822e7c06f9bf5a OP_EQUAL
- address
- 3MEs4mPQbafauuNyRSXVFpwpSaH3PjT25z